I suppose he did, considering they scored somethign like 20 straight points when franks went out. Granted franks is trash so not sure how big a deal that is.

I was watching the game and I think it was immediately noticeable to anyone else watching that somehow, inexplicably for seemingly no reason, when trask came in UK played what seemed like a prevent defense. You've got an inexperienced backup coming in cold, logic would dictate you pressure the hell out of him and confuse him. UK had their CBs playign damn near 15 yards off the LOS, Trask was just throwing little 10 yard curls every drive and movign the chains.

Yet to be seen if he's an upgrade, although again franks is pretty bad, but I dont' think the UK game is much of an indicator.

Trask entered the game at the beginning of the 4th quarter.
He was 9 of 13 for 126 yards, 0 TD, 0 INT. And 1 rush for 4 yards. As Florida scored 19 unanswered points.
